Discover Microsoft funding and tools that support accessible innovation for the development of assistive technology by and ...The Disability Discrimination Act (DDA) makes it against the law for public places to be inaccessible to people with a disability. This applies to existing places as well as places under construction. Feb 28, 2020 · Under the new rules, covered entities must allow people with disabilities who use wheelchairs (including manual wheelchairs, power wheelchairs, and electric scooters) and manually-powered mobility aids such as walkers, crutches, canes, braces, and other similar devices into all areas of a facility where members of the public are allowed to go.

Entry door: “The door to the bathroom must be wide enough to admit a wheelchair,” says South. That means a minimum of 42-in. wide and no more than a 1/2-in.-high threshold. Toilet: The space for the toilet should have at least 15 inches from the center of the bowl to a wall or other object, says Hysmith. When websites and web tools are properly designed and coded, people with disabilities can use them. However, currently many sites and tools are developed with accessibility barriers that make them difficult or impossible for some people to use. The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) standards are stable and referenceable when they are published as a ‘W3C Recommendation’ web standard. WCAG 2.0 was published on 11 December 2008. WCAG 2.1 was published on 5 June 2018, and an update was published on 21 September 2023.
